    All the fabrics in the Quilt are by Fabric Freedom of London. These are very high quality quiliting cottons that use extremely high quality dyes and finishing techniques and are on very high-quality base fabric so their hand is great and the colors really pop. They are not widely distributed in the USA, being more available in England and Australia. (Full disclosure: Our online store is the largest online Fabric Freedom seller on the internet).

    The main fabrics in the quilt are from Fabric Freedom's new Deco Delight line - red/rust colorway. There are five different fabrics in the quilt from this line.

    The background fabrics are from Fabric Freedom's Perfect Palette line of dye-matched blenders. All FF fabrics use the color palette represented in this blender line in some manner, so the light and dark backgrounds in these quilts will perfectly match with elements of the Deco Delight fabrics. Each Perfect Palette blender uses 8 screens of different colors to make a wide variation of the colors that will work with them. These variations also give them a nice "cloud" effect.

    The pattern for these quilts is Shenandoah, by Creative Sewlutions.
